1910-S $5 MS64 PCGS.<p>The 1910-S compares favorably to the 1909-S in terms of striking characteristics. This is a sharply impressed coin with lovely reddish-gold patina. The texture is softly frosted, the mintmark is well defined, and the only mentionable abrasion is a tiny reeding mark in the reverse field behind the eagle's head. The San Francisco Mint delivered 770,200 Half Eagles in 1910, a respectable total for the Indian series. Nonetheless, this issue is rare in all Mint State grades, and nearly all Uncirculated survivors are confined to the MS60-63 grade levels. No more than 8-10 coins are believed extant at or above the MS65 level. Population: 15 in 64, with a mere four finer (11/01).
